We can probably all relate to the pain of trying to remember passwords. Online shopping, banking, emails, apps and social media – it’s reported that many of us have at least 90 different accounts that require passwords.
But it’s increasingly the case that, when you set up a new account or install an app, you’ll be asked, ‘Do you want to continue with Google? Or Facebook?’ Select either one and you’re straight in – no new account or password required.
That’s Single Sign On in action. Your credentials in one place are used to verify your access somewhere else. And after this happens once, you don’t have to keep entering your details on repeat visits. Pretty convenient, right?
